    William Nigel Ernle Bruce (4 February 1895 – 8 October 1953) was a British character actor on stage and screen. He was best known for his portrayal of Dr. Watson in a series of films and in the radio series The New Adventures of Sherlock Holmes, starring with Basil Rathbone as Sherlock Holmes in both.

    Nigel Bruce was an English actor who played various roles of British characters in Hollywood films, such as Sherlock Holmes, Dr. Watson, and British detectives. He was born in Mexico, where his family was part of the English aristocracy, and served in the British Army during World War I. He died in 1953 from a heart attack.

A series of fourteen films based on Sir Arthur Conan Doyle's Sherlock Holmes stories was released between 1939 and 1946; British actors Basil Rathbone and Nigel Bruce portrayed Sherlock Holmes and Dr. John Watson, respectively.
